This is OK, you might say a return to form, but it's more of a return to what the fans want but even then it's just like a good TV movie. It starts with a little bit of a political assassination akin to Star Trek VI, but rather than be a basis for the plot it's largely forgotten about.

So it's not a good thriller like The Undiscovered Country was. So what do fans want? Fights. Fights with laaazerrrs and the Enterprise getting beat up but ultimately winning with some outlandish outmaneuver (and what a maneuver!) against some aliens in their ship that will have a cloaking device (everyone else has one but us).

Well all that is there but doesn't quite pack the punch as previous Trek space battles have seen. I liked who the villain was but I don't think his character was explored well enough, there was little explanation about anything that raised a question in the plot.

Over all its good and certainly easier to watch than say half of the Treks before it.

This review of Star Trek: Nemesis (2002) was written by on 02 Sep 2009.
